Who We Are - About NewGlobe

NewGlobe works with visionary governments around the world to dramatically improve the quality of basic education. Founded in 2007, we partner with governments to provide integrated school management, teacher professional development, instructional design innovation, technological system support, child-centered classroom practice, and parent engagement -- all grounded in learning science -- to ensure each teacher is empowered to engage children in transformational learning, Our data-driven approach has been validated by a Nobel-winning researcher and recognition by international leaders in Education. We imagine a world where all children can access an education that unlocks their full potential.

About the Role

NewGlobe’s unique Education Transformation System is empirically proven to help governments improve education outcomes at significant scale—regardless of students’ gender, wealth, location, parental education level, or home language spoken. Our uniquely holistic solution includes cutting edge pedagogies, technologies, data availability and access, administrative support and techniques. The role of the Global Solutions Manager is to create and own a suite of content, campaigns and trainings to help audiences—both internal and external—communicate and understand the value of our solution(s).

What You Will Do

  • Create and own a set of global content matched to the buyer’s journey that articulates NewGlobe’s solutions and methodologies
  • Collaborate deeply with our policies and partnerships, academics, schools, and marketing teams to build and refine content that educates and explains
  • Perform qualitative research with internal and external audiences to understand content/messaging gaps and opportunities
  • Create and manage rollout campaigns for new releases
  • Build training materials that improve internal teams’ fluency and understanding of NewGlobe’s solutions
  • Work directly with field marketing teams to help them understand how to customize global content, and incorporate their learnings into future iterations of that global content
